About the role

As a Growth Product Manager, you put the customer experience at the center of every decision. You work with the product team to evaluate the impact that features and improvements have on our business goals, and you act upon the lessons learned. You are the interface between business, product, and user experience, and you pave the way to product-led growth for one of our modules.

We are fully remote until Covid-19 pandemic is declared over and it is safe to socialize. In the Post-Covid-19 reality we offer hybrid model, a fusion of remote and at-the-office work.

You’ll be responsible for:

  • Measuring and analyzing adoption and business indicators to determine how well the product is performing in the market, how it impacts company operations, and, ultimately, how it contributes to profit.
  • Shaping a methodical approach that enables Solution Leadership Teams to tie agile value increments to customer value, ARR, and user adoption.
  • Initiating value validation with internal and external users, both qual & quant (for instance, A/B tests).
  • Evangelizing for OKRs and supporting Solution teams with implementation and execution.
  • Influencing the team’s business acumen through your customer value driven mindset.

Desired skills & experience:

  • Several years of related work experience in the IT industry, such as Product Management, Software Product Design, UX
  • Design, or the equivalent combination of transferable experience and education.
  • A good understanding of sales cycles & up/cross-selling in Enterprise SaaS environments and the ability to distinguish between buyer and user profiles.
  • Validated conceptual and analytical skills and fluency in analytics, usability tests, and other forms of qualitative and quantitative feedback.
  • Ability to understand the requirements of the market and capability to engender confidence that assignments are on track and on strategy.
  • Ability and persistence to break through organizational boundaries and navigate through a complex environment without losing focus.
